diff options
author | Hans Ulrich Niedermann <hun@n-dimensional.de> | 2008-07-26 10:30:02 +0200 |
---|---|---|
committer | Hans Ulrich Niedermann <hun@n-dimensional.de> | 2008-07-26 11:11:08 +0200 |
commit | fefebc702664a683ceeafa800b0fe75178d63037 (patch) | |
tree | b76a1f157647e187ea2706509a5f60bc6dd545ee /build-helpers | |
parent | 330c382390ffbe3c361a763d5cee6febe1b30f5e (diff) | |
download | nbb-fefebc702664a683ceeafa800b0fe75178d63037.tar.gz nbb-fefebc702664a683ceeafa800b0fe75178d63037.tar.xz nbb-fefebc702664a683ceeafa800b0fe75178d63037.zip |
Switch to release tags including the package name
This will reduce tag confusion when we fork into a
different project.
A tag like nbb-1.2 or foo-tools-1.2 is much more useful
than v1.2.
Diffstat (limited to 'build-helpers')
-rwxr-xr-x | build-helpers/package-version |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/build-helpers/package-version b/build-helpers/package-version index 61a3018..f81bcd4 100755 --- a/build-helpers/package-version +++ b/build-helpers/package-version @@ -21,7 +21,8 @@ if test -f "$top_srcdir/$version_stamp"; then # dist source tree cat "$top_srcdir/$version_stamp" | ${TR-tr} -d '\012' elif test -d "$GIT_DIR"; then # git source tree git_describe=`${GIT-git} describe 2>/dev/null || echo devel` - echo "$git_describe" | ${SED-sed} 's/^v//;s/-/./;s/-g/-/' | ${TR-tr} -d '\012' + # change tags like "foo-conf-1.2" to "1.2" + echo "$git_describe" | ${SED-sed} 's/^\([A-Za-z0-9_-]\{1,\}\)-\([0-9]\)/\2/;s/-/./;s/-g/-/' | ${TR-tr} -d '\012' else # ??? echo "devel" | ${TR-tr} -d '\012' fi |